One Punch Man Video Game Announced for Consoles

One Punch Man is getting a pair of new games based on the exploits of Saitama, Genos and the rest of the heroes anime and manga fans love.

The development of the new console game is being lead by Spike Chunsoft, the studio most well-known for the Danganrompa series of quirky Japanese titles. This newest outing will bring many beloved characters from the manga/anime to life in a new game called One Punch Man: A Hero Nobody Knows.

One Punch Man: A Hero Nobody Knows will feature of course Saitama, as well as the cyborg Genos, Hellish Blizzard, Speed o’ Sound Sonic, and even Mumen Rider. The trailer shows off the most powerful bad guy from season one of the anime, Boros. This suggests that the game will be a retelling of the first season of the anime.

The anime and manga property details the exploits of unlikely hero Saitama, who is able to take down foes with little to no effort, often using just a single punch. He gained this insane level of power after engaging in a superhuman level of training, and part of his character arc revolves around overcoming the assumptions people have about his physical ability.

Spike Chunsoft and Bandai Namco have yet to reveal many details about the game, but there is a new gameplay trailer, which can be viewed below. We do know that the gameplay loop will center around the concept of a 3v3 fighter, and is “coming soon” to PlayStation 4, Windows PC, and Xbox One. One neat detail is that the game’s audio will be entirely in Japanese, so no dub dialogue here.

This is of course one of two different games in development based on the iconic property. One Punch Man is also getting a turn-based mix of card game and RPG for mobile devices. One-Punch Man: Road to Hero was also announced for iOS and Android mobile devices, and it’s set to launch later, after this mainline console title. We don’t know the exact date, but the mobile game is set to release after the second season of the anime.

One Punch Man: A Hero Nobody Knows is in development for PC, PS4, and Xbox One.
